Novosibirsk, the third-largest city in Russia, has emerged as a dynamic and growing hub in Siberia. With its expanding economy, improving infrastructure, and vibrant cultural scene, the city offers significant potential for real estate investors. Whether you’re looking for residential properties, commercial spaces, or long-term rental opportunities, Novosibirsk has diverse areas to explore for investment.

In this guide, we’ll explore the best places to invest in real estate in Novosibirsk, highlighting promising neighborhoods and districts that offer attractive opportunities for buyers and investors.

1. Leninsky District (City Center)

What to Expect:

  • The Leninsky District is the heart of Novosibirsk, offering a mix of residential, commercial, and retail properties. It’s one of the most desirable areas for investment, thanks to its proximity to major business hubs, government buildings, and cultural attractions like the Novosibirsk Opera and Ballet Theatre and Lenin Square.
  • In terms of residential real estate, the district offers both luxury apartments and more affordable housing options, making it ideal for investors interested in long-term rental properties. Its central location makes it a highly sought-after area for residents, young professionals, and expats.
  • The commercial real estate market is also active, with demand for office spaces, retail stores, and restaurants. The proximity to business districts and universities makes this area appealing for commercial investment.

Why Invest:

  • High demand for both residential and commercial properties due to its prime location in the city.
  • Ideal for those looking to capitalize on long-term rental income or invest in properties with high resale value.

Practical Tip:

  • Be sure to consider the traffic and transportation access in this area. Properties near metro stations or bus stops are particularly valuable.

2. Zheleznodorozhny District

What to Expect:

  • The Zheleznodorozhny District is known for its proximity to the railway station and major transportation hubs. This area has seen significant development in recent years, making it a great spot for investors looking for affordable real estate with growth potential.
  • This district is home to a variety of residential buildings, ranging from newly developed complexes to older Soviet-era buildings that may offer renovation opportunities. The demand for affordable housing in this district continues to grow as Novosibirsk’s population increases.
  • The area also offers commercial properties, including shops and office spaces, thanks to its high traffic from travelers and commuters.

Why Invest:

  • Affordable property prices compared to the city center with room for value appreciation.
  • Strong demand for affordable housing and business rental spaces near transportation hubs.

Practical Tip:

  • Look for property development projects or renovation opportunities that can be purchased below market value and sold at a higher price after upgrades.

3. Kalinin District

What to Expect:

  • The Kalinin District is an up-and-coming residential area located to the north of the city center. Over the past few years, the district has seen an increase in new residential developments, as well as improving infrastructure like schools, parks, and shopping centers.
  • This area is popular with young professionals and families due to its more affordable property prices compared to more central districts. It is well connected to the rest of the city by public transportation, making it a great option for first-time homebuyers and renters.
  • There are several opportunities for investors to buy apartment complexes or mixed-use residential buildings for rental income, particularly as demand for affordable housing continues to rise.

Why Invest:

  • Growing demand for residential real estate in an up-and-coming neighborhood with increasing property values.
  • Opportunity for investment in rental properties or new developments.

Practical Tip:

  • Focus on properties near new shopping centers or parks as these locations tend to attract higher rents and have greater potential for future growth.

4. Centralny District

What to Expect:

  • The Centralny District is home to some of the city’s most prestigious and sought-after properties. With its proximity to government buildings, business districts, and cultural venues, this area is ideal for high-end residential real estate investment.
  • The district offers a range of luxury apartments, historical buildings, and high-end commercial properties, making it perfect for investors looking for premium assets. Renovation projects in this district can provide substantial returns, especially in heritage buildings or unique spaces.
  • As the cultural and commercial heart of Novosibirsk, this district has seen a constant influx of investors and foreign interest, ensuring a strong market for high-end real estate.

Why Invest:

  • High-end residential and commercial properties offer the potential for high returns on investment, especially in the form of luxury rentals or long-term capital appreciation.
  • Ideal for investors looking for premium properties with high demand and resale value.

Practical Tip:

  • Look for properties near cultural landmarks or public transportation to attract both luxury tenants and potential buyers.
